Cow's milk for babies: when and how?
From the start of solids at around 6 months you can offer cow's milk. The way you prepare it decides. Only cooked into the milk and cereal porridge.

How to prepare it, by age
All three stages stand side by side. We don't know how old your child is, so read the stage that fits you.
At 6 months
Only cooked into the milk and cereal porridge. Not as a drink yet.
From 9 months
Still only in purée or in cooking, not in the cup.
From 12 months
From a cup, at most about 200 ml a day. Not as a thirst quencher from the bottle.

A tip from everyday life
It comes down to the amount. Cow's milk is fine in milk and cereal porridge, not as a thirst quencher from the bottle. Too much protein strains the kidneys.
Allergens
Main allergen under EU law: Milk. EAACI and the German S3 guideline on allergy prevention speak for introducing common allergens early and then offering them regularly. Avoiding them does not protect against an allergy.

The five safety rules
- Quarter round food lengthwise. Grapes, cherries and cherry tomatoes never go on the plate whole.
- Cook hard food soft or grate it finely. Raw carrot and raw apple break into hard pieces otherwise.
- Nuts are never whole, only as a butter or finely ground.
- Eating happens sitting upright, never lying down and never on the move.
- Stay with your baby while they eat. Choking happens silently.
